Fourth of July Celebrations PDF Print E-mail
Written by Mindi Etheridge   
Wednesday, 28 June 2006

Red, White, & Summer Blues Festival Saturday 1st - Kick off the 4th of July celebration in downtown Manson. Enjoy Blues by The Jeff Paige band from 12 – 5 pm. Vendors with beads, jewelry, and food; Seed Spitting Contest; Watermelon Eating Contest; Face Painting; Kids Play Area; Kids Carnival Games & Beer Garden 10 – 6 pm. 687-3111Image

Kiwanis Bar B Q Chicken Dinner  Sunday 2nd - Manson Kiwanis 43rd Annual Bar B Q includes 1/2 chicken, Leo's famous cole slaw, baked beans, garlic bread, and coffee & juice for only $8. At the Manson Grange 12 noon - 5 pm. 687-9017

Manson Bay Fireworks Show Tuesday 4th - Join us as we celebrate our patriotic independence with a spectacular fireworks shows over Manson Bay Park
starting 10 pm. 687-3111

4th of July Fireworks Cruise Tuesday 4th - View the fireworks show aboard the Lady of the Lake II boarding 8 pm, departing promptly 8:30 pm, returning approx. 11:30 pm. Tickets $9 per person, under 2 free, available at the Lake Chelan Boat Company. Space is limited to 250 people, pre-purchase suggested. 682-4584

Lake Chelan Chamber Members;
 
There has been lots of discussion regarding the status of the World Endurance Sports Triathlons scheduled for July 8th through July 19th.  As of today, World Endurance Sports does not have authorization to use the City parks or School District property for the races.  The Chamber Board has decided not to partner with World Endurance Sports.  The potential impact of not having this series of races is large.  The Chamber investigated several options.  Based on a series of meetings, emails from participants, discussions with other Race Organizers, discussion with Chamber members, discussions with Chamber staff, and discussions local agencies (City, Sheriff, EMS, Fire District, etc.) the Chamber Board decided to;
  • NOT organize triathlons for July 2006.
  • Coordinate a community wide program to welcome Tri-athletes to Lake Chelan.
  • Coordinate a special 'Lake Chelan Fun' Coupon book for registered participants with special discounts.
  • Encourage Hotels/Motels to provide a discount for registered Triathlon participants
  • Coordinate 'informal' bike rides with stops at wineries (South shore to State Park), North shore (Boyd loop)
  • Work with local Bike Club to coordinate Mountain Bike rides at Echo Ridge
  • Provide Welcome Banner for Tri-athletes
  • Welcome poster for Chamber Member windows
  • Coordinate Fun Run for registered participants on July 8th and July 15th using the Chelan Chase Course
  • Notify participants of the Triathlon schedule for August at Daroga State Park.
  • Plan Lake Chelan Triathlons for June 2007 and late September / early October 2007 working with a local race organizer.
We need your support to make this a good Lake Chelan experience for the tri-athletes regardless of whether there are or are not formal races.  If you have questions please call me at the Chamber.

Chamber Plans Special Events for Tri-athletes PDF Print E-mail
Written by Gregory Kennedy   
Tuesday, 27 June 2006

Chelan, Washington – The Lake Chelan Chamber of Commerce, Board of Directors has decided to coordinate a community wide program to welcome Tri-athletes to Lake Chelan regardless of the status of the triathlons. 

On June 21st the Board said no to an agreement with World Endurance Sports to provide staffing and support for the My First, My Next and Half Ironman Triathlons scheduled between July 8 and July 19, 2006.  Since June 21st the Chamber Board and staff have been investigating options to provide a good experience for the people visiting the Lake Chelan area for the triathlons.  Dan Hodge, Executive Director, Lake Chelan Chamber of Commerce said “The Chamber Board is concerned about the reaction of participants when they find out the events organized by World Endurance Sports may not happen.   The Chamber will be coordinating a community wide program to welcome the Tri-athletes to the Lake Chelan community.” 

The Chamber is organizing a special ‘Lake Chelan Fun Book’ for registered participants that will include special discounts for stores, restaurants and attractions.  There will also be information on informal self-directed bike rides that that go along the north shore and south shore of Lake Chelan.  The Chamber will be working with local bike groups to showcase the Echo Valley Mountain bike trails for the Tri-athletes.    The Chamber is planning a fun run for July 8th and July 15th if the World Endurance Sports triathlons do not occur on those dates.

The Chamber will be working to contact Triathlon participants to inform them of the status of the triathlon and what the community is doing to provide interesting activities.   There are several activities in Lake Chelan in mid July including First Friday – July 7th, Family Fest – July 8th, Bach Fest July 8th through 15th, the Riverwalk Concert with Alice Stuart – July 21st and Chelan Rodeo July 21st and 22nd.

The Chamber is posting information regarding the status of the Triathlons on the Chamber website www.lakechelan.com.  If people are interested in helping plan and organize the Triathlon events or have questions they can contact Dan or Jaye at the Chamber office, 509-682-3503.

 
Chamber Executive to Leave in September PDF Print E-mail
Written by Gregory Kennedy   
Monday, 26 June 2006

Dan Hodge resigns to achieve better balance

 

Chelan, Washington – Dan Hodge, Executive Director, Lake Chelan Chamber of Commerce announced he is leaving the Chamber effective September 15, 2006.  He has served as the Executive Director for the Chamber since late 2003.  Dan will be taking time to achieve a better life balance and spend more time with his family.Image

Dan said, “The decision to resign was based on my need to focus more attention on an appropriate balance for my life.  I have really enjoyed working with the Chamber Board, Chamber staff, Chamber members and the Lake Chelan community.”

Dan was hired in September 2003 and worked part-time through the end of 2003.  He started full-time in January 2004.  Prior to starting at the Lake Chelan Chamber of Commerce he had worked for Comcast Cable.  In January 2003 he accepted a severance package, which enabled him to retire to spend more time in Chelan.  During 2003 he decided to move permanently to their vacation home at Lake Chelan.  Dan and his wife Mary will be staying at their home in Chelan except for some travel to spend time with family and friends.

The Chamber Board will be posting the Executive Director position by early July and plan to hire a new Executive Director by September 1st.  Questions or inquiries can be directed to Dan Hodge, at the Lake Chelan Chamber of Commerce on 509-682-3503.

Lake Chelan Triathlon Status

The Lake Chelan Chamber issued a press release last Thursday regarding the status of the seven triathlons scheduled in the Lake Chelan area for July 8th – 19th.  These races can bring 2000 to 5000 people to the Valley.  The Chamber Board asked me to work with World Endurance Sports to reach an agreement to overcome the concerns and objections of the City, EMS, School District and others.  As of last Wednesday it became apparent we could not reach a satisfactory agreement.  The Chamber Board is very concerned about the impact that not having these races will have on local businesses and the participants’ perception of Lake Chelan.  We are working to notify participants of the status of the triathlons, and to see if it possible to organize safe, fun races for July 8th through July 19thDoing these events will take a massive community effort.  It will be expensive, and require 40-60 volunteers for each event.  But we are committed to providing a good experience for those participants who decide to come to Chelan.   The Chamber is planning an organizing committee meeting for Monday, June 26, 2006 at the Chamber office at 5:00 PM.  After that meeting we will make a decision about what can be done.  If people are interested in helping plan and organize the Triathlon events or have questions they can contact Dan or Jaye at the Chamber office, 509-682-3503.  The Chamber is posting information regarding the status of the Triathlons on the Chamber website www.lakechelan.com.
